Position Summary
Provides overall coordination and management for research activities in the Kidney Transplant Research Laboratory. Manages and conducts research activities for the Kidney Transplant Research Laboratory which includes daily experimental design and execution, data analysis/interpretation and ordering maintenance of laboratory supplies/equipment. Responsible for assisting with developing protocols and regulatory documents in collaboration with the Principal Investigator, to include supervision of laboratory personnel and laboratory budget responsibilities.
